First aired: April 7, 2014.The New York Immigration Coalition is an umbrella policy and advocacy organization in support of nearly 200 groups, that work with immigrants and refugees. DACA, (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als) is one of NYIC's programs. Elizabeth Plum, DACA's Outreach Coordinator urges immigrants to contact the organization for information and eligibility.
